The South Carolina Research Authority (SCRA) was chartered to advance scientific research and development within South Carolina. Its core mission is to foster innovation and economic growth by providing support and funding for translational research and technology-based startups. SCRA offers services in advanced materials, metals, shipbuilding, and defense prototypes, focusing on partnerships with industry, startups, and academic institutions. The organization also provides high-quality laboratory and administrative workspaces to facilitate these endeavors.
Notable affiliates include various academic startups and industry partners that have benefited from SCRA's funding and support. Key achievements include the acceptance of companies like MyUI.AI and SMPL-C as member companies and the awarding of new grant funding to MASDEV. SCRA's impact is evident in its role in accelerating the growth of academic startups and fostering technological advancements, significantly contributing to South Carolina's innovation ecosystem.

South Carolina Research Authority was founded in 1983.
South Carolina Research Authority's headquarters is located in Columbia, SC, US.
South Carolina Research Authority's most recent funding round was for $750k (USD) in February 2019.
As of Feb 5, 2019, South Carolina Research Authority has raised a total of $750k (USD).
South Carolina Research Authority has 42 employees as of Feb 4, 2024.
